New Kennett Library Breaks Ground

New Kennett LibrarySubmitted Image

KENNETT SQUARE, PA — The Chester County Library System announced the new Kennett Library groundbreaking ceremony was held on August 12. The event was attended by local elected officials, as well as CCLS staff and Board members.

Officials state the new Kennett Library and Resource Center will provide the structure, space, and infrastructure needed now and for the future, that not only enhances the traditional role of a Library, but serves as a gathering place, a hub for community meetings and activities, and a vital resource welcoming to all.
